True Lavender (Lavandula angustifolia) from Starke Ayres is a perennial herbaceous shrub known for its fragrant grey foliage and long flowering stems. It is widely cultivated for ornamental borders, dried flower arrangements, and essential oil extraction. This variety thrives in full sun, tolerates semi-shade, and is suitable for tray or direct sowing. It prefers well-drained soil and is drought-tolerant once established. Seeds are chemically treated and hermetically sealed. Not intended for food, feed, or processing.
TECHNICAL DETAILS:
Feature | Description |
Product Name | True Lavender |
Botanical Name | Lavandula angustifolia |
Supplier | Starke Ayres (PTY) Ltd – South Africa |
Plant Type | Perennial herb |
Growth Habit | Grey-hairy shrub with long stems |
Uses | Ornamental, perfumery, dried flowers |
Germination | 21–90 days |
Days to Harvest | 90–150 days |
Sowing Seasons | Spring, Summer, Autumn, Winter |
Light Requirement | Full sun, semi-shade, or shade |
Sowing Method | Tray or direct |
Sowing Depth | 5 mm |
Spacing | 30 cm |
Treatment | Chemically treated seed |
Packaging | Hermetically sealed – approx. 0.7 g |
Safety Notice | Do not use for food, feed, or processing |
